Watermelon Iced Tea

Melanie Lorick
A summertime drink that fuses one of summer's most lovable fruits with classic iced tea. Refreshing and tasty!
No ratings yet
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Drinks
Cuisine American
Servings 10 people

Ingredients
  

  • 15 Stevia bags
  • 10 cups water approximate
  • 5 black tea sachéts
  • 2 cups chopped watermelon seeds removed
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da

Instructions
 

  • In a saucepan, bring 4 cups of water to a boil. Remove from heat and add 5 black tea bags. Steep for about 5 minutes.
  • In a separate saucepan, bring 1 ½ cups water to a boil. Remove from heat and stir in 15 Stevia bags.
  • Allow liquids from both saucepans to cool.
  • In a food processor, pulse 2 cups of chopped watermelon. Strain to remove watermelon flesh and any rogue seeds.
  • Combine all liquids in a pitcher, add water to fill pitcher (4 - 8 more cups) and stir in 1 teaspoon baking soda to help maintain red color. Chill for several hours before serving.
